Since it would probably be better for you to search directly, I'll tell you how I found one game in particular.

Somebody asked for a game about piloting a submarine, and there was a miniature town on the bottom of the ocean that was so small, your house gets crushed by an empty soup can that a human tosses from his boat. And then you have to perform salvage missions. The actual description in the thread was longer, but I found that game in less than 15 minutes despite never playing it. I used three words:

Game, Submarine, Salvage

It was #6 from the top in Google lol. I would start by searching for sentences like 'classic pc games' or 'DOS games', that sort of thing.
